新闻中心
如何使用CSS设置元素背景平铺_background-repeat background-size应用
通过background-repeat和background-size可控制背景图平铺与尺寸。1. background-repeat取值有repeat、no-repeat、repeat-x、repeat-y、space、round,用于设置图像平铺方式;2. background-size取值包括auto、具体宽高、百分比、cover、contain,用于调整图像大小;3. 结合使用可实现如全屏背景图效果,常配background-position:center,使图像居中覆盖容器,提升页面视觉体验。

在网页设计中,背景图的显示效果对整体视觉体验影响很大。通过 background-repeat 和 background-size 这两个CSS属性,可以灵活控制背景图像的平铺方式和尺寸,让页面更美观、适配性更强。
background-repeat:控制背景图是否平铺
默认情况下,背景图会沿着水平和垂直方向重复平铺。使用 background-repeat 可以修改这一行为。
常用取值:- repeat:默认值,图像在横向和纵向都平铺
- no-repeat:图像不平铺,只显示一次
- repeat-x:只在水平方向平铺
- repeat-y:只在垂直方向平铺
- space:图像不裁剪,用空白间距填满容器
- round:图像缩放以适应空间,避免留白
例如,设置一个不平铺的背景图:
div {
background-image: url('bg.jpg');
background-repeat: no-repeat;
}
background-size:调整背景图尺寸
这个属性用于定义背景图像的大小,特别适合响应式设计,让图片在不同设备上都能良好展示。
常见取值:- auto:保持原始尺寸(默认)
- 100px 200px:指定具体宽高(可分别设置宽高)
- 50% 100%:按容器百分比缩放
- cover:等比例缩放图像,完全覆盖容器,可能裁剪
- contain:等比例缩放,完整显示图像,可能留白
比如让背景图撑满整个元素:
Tanka
具备AI长期记忆的下一代团队协作沟通工具
146
查看详情
div {
background-image: url('hero.jpg');
background-repeat: no-repeat;
background-size: cover;
}
结合使用实现理想效果
实际开发中,这两个属性常一起设置。例如做一个全屏背景图区域:
.hero-section {
width: 100%;
height: 100vh;
background-image: url('landscape.jpg');
background-repeat: no-repeat;
background-size: cover;
background-position: center;
}
这样能确保背景图居中显示、充满视口,且不会重复出现。
基本上就这些。掌握 background-repeat 和 background-size 的搭配,就能轻松处理大多数背景图需求,让页面看起来更专业、更协调。
以上就是如何使用CSS设置元素背景平铺_background-repeat background-size应用的
详细内容,更多请关注其它相关文章!
# 这一
# 黑河关键词seo
# 五峰市场智能营销推广单位
# 传媒推广营销视频素材图片
# 重庆行业门户网站建设
# 禅城区企业网络营销推广
# seo上首页秘密
# 公司网站建设u
# 乌海问答营销推广
# 网站大数据优化
# 盐城网站建设商城官网
# 选择器
# css
# 两种类型
# 中不
# 全屏
# 只在
# 这两个
# 如何使用
# 平铺
# css属性
# 响应式设计
# 网页设计
# ai
相关栏目:
【
科技资讯46185 】
【
网络学院92790 】
相关推荐:
PHP中获取MongoDB服务器运行时间(Uptime)的专业指南
c++如何使用折叠表达式(Fold Expressions)_c++17可变参数模板新技巧
解决Python单元测试中Mock异常方法调用计数为零的问题
Go语言中JSON数据解析与字段访问教程
想当下一个《2077》?《心之眼》Steam评价升至"多半好评"
Windows10怎么开启存储感知 Windows10系统设置自动清理临时文件释放C盘空间【教程】
TikTok搜索结果不显示如何解决 TikTok搜索刷新优化方法
J*aScript中如何高效提取对象指定属性
Discord Slash 命令响应超时问题的异步解决方案
outlook中文官网入口地址 outlook官方中文版直达首页链接
我的世界mc.js免费游戏直接能玩 我的世界mc.js小游戏免费秒玩入口
LINUX的I/O重定向是什么_深入理解LINUX中 >、>> 与 < 的区别
12306选座如何查看座位示意图_12306座位示意图解读与使用
HuggingFaceEmbeddings中向量嵌入维度调整的限制与理解
J*a实现学校排课程序_面向对象结构化项目示例
mysql如何设置表访问权限_mysql表访问权限配置
夸克浏览器桌面版同步不了书签怎么处理 夸克浏览器跨设备同步异常解决方案
火锅吃太多会怎样 火锅吃太多会上火吗
PHP URL参数传递与500错误调试指南
uc浏览器网页版入口 uc浏览器网页版最新网址
如何在 Excel Online 和 Google 表格中更改日期格式
微信商城在哪里打开【步骤】
如何更改在 Excel 中打开超链接时的默认浏览器
Yandex官方入口网址 Yandex俄罗斯搜索引擎最新在线地址
快手赚钱渠道_快手收益来源
在Runstone环境中高效处理TasteDive API的JSON数据
搜狗浏览器如何使用密码生成器创建强密码 搜狗浏览器内置密码安全工具
怎么在mac上运行html代码_mac运行html代码方法【指南】
C++如何使用AddressSanitizer(ASan)_C++调试工具中检测内存访问错误的利器
Django AJAX 文件上传教程:解决图片无法保存到模型的常见问题
QQ邮箱登录首页官网地址2026 QQ邮箱官方网页入口
在J*aScript中复现SciPy的B样条拟合与求值:关键考量
Bilibili动漫最新防封地址发布-Bilibili动漫2025年最稳正版入口推荐
J*aScript类型检查_j*ascript代码规范
如何在CSS中使用浮动制作导航栏_float实现水平菜单
4399体育竞技小游戏_4399小游戏赛事入口
AI抖音网页版免费视频入口 AI抖音网页端最新视频实时观看
J*a递归快速排序中静态变量的状态管理与陷阱
win11开机启动修复循环怎么办 Win11无法进入系统高级启动解决方法【修复】
Android Studio计算器C键逻辑错误排查与修复:条件判断优化指南
NRF24L01数据传输深度解析:解决大载荷接收异常与分包策略
c++如何使用chrono库处理时间_c++标准库时间与日期操作
为什么简单的XML文件也会解析失败? 检查隐藏的非打印字符(如BOM)的方法
印象笔记怎样用批量导出备知识库_印象笔记用批量导出备知识库【备份方法】
韩剧圈正版入口页面_韩剧圈官网登录链接
J*aScript中赋值与自增运算符的复杂交互与执行机制
2026春节假期票务安排_2026春节放假购票指南
msn官网入口地址手机版 msn官方网站手机最新链接
HTML空白字符处理机制:渲染、DOM与编码实践
谷歌学术网站直达地址 谷歌学术搜索网页版一键进入


2025-11-13
浏览次数:次
返回列表